+/**
+ * virTypedParamsGet:
+ * @params: array of typed parameters
+ * @nparams: number of parameters in the @params array
+ * @name: name of the parameter to find
+ *
+ * Finds typed parameter called @name.
+ *
+ * Returns pointer to the parameter or NULL if it does not exist in @params.
+ */
+virTypedParameterPtr
+virTypedParamsGet(virTypedParameterPtr params,
+ int nparams,
+ const char *name)
+{
+ int i;
+
+ virResetLastError();
+
+ if (!params || !name)
+ return NULL;
+
+ for (i = 0; i < nparams; i++) {
+ if (STREQ(params[i].field, name))
+ return params + i;
+ }
+
+ return NULL;
+}

+/**
+ * virTypedParamsGetString:
+ * @params: array of typed parameters
+ * @nparams: number of parameters in the @params array
+ * @name: name of the parameter to find
+ * @value: where to store the parameter's value
+ *
+ * Finds typed parameter called @name and store its char * value in @value.
+ * The function does not create a copy of the string and the caller must not
+ * free the string @value points to. The function fails with
+ * VIR_ERR_INVALID_ARG error if the parameter does not have the expected type.
+ * By passing NULL as @value, the function may be used to check presence and
+ * type of the parameter.
+ *
+ * Returns 1 on success, 0 when the parameter does not exist in @params, or
+ * -1 on error.
+ */
+int
+virTypedParamsGetString(virTypedParameterPtr params,
+ int nparams,
+ const char *name,
+ const char **value)
+{
+ virTypedParameterPtr param;
+
+ virResetLastError();
+
+ if (!(param = virTypedParamsGet(params, nparams, name)))
+ return 0;
+
+ VIR_TYPED_PARAM_CHECK_TYPE(VIR_TYPED_PARAM_STRING);
+ if (value)
+ *value = param->value.s;
+
+ return 1;
+}

+/**
+ * virTypedParamsAddString:
+ * @params: pointer to the array of typed parameters
+ * @nparams: number of parameters in the @params array
+ * @maxparams: maximum number of parameters that can be stored in @params
+ * array without allocating more memory
+ * @name: name of the parameter to find
+ * @value: the value to store into the new parameter
+ *
+ * Adds new parameter called @name with char * type and sets its value to
+ * @value. The function creates its own copy of @value string, which needs to
+ * be freed using virTypedParamsFree. If @params array
+ * points to NULL or to a space that is not large enough to accommodate the
+ * new parameter (@maxparams < @nparams + 1), the function allocates more
+ * space for it and updates @maxparams. On success, @nparams is incremented
+ * by one. The function fails with VIR_ERR_INVALID_ARG error if the parameter
+ * already exists in @params.
+ *
+ * Returns 0 on success, -1 on error.
+ */
+int
+virTypedParamsAddString(virTypedParameterPtr *params,
+ int *nparams,
+ int *maxparams,
+ const char *name,
+ const char *value)
+{
+ char *str = NULL;
+ size_t max = *maxparams;
+ size_t n = *nparams;
+
+ virResetLastError();
+
+ VIR_TYPED_PARAM_CHECK();
+ if (VIR_RESIZE_N(*params, max, n, 1) < 0) {
+ virReportOOMError();
+ goto error;
+ }
+ *maxparams = max;
+
+ if (value && !(str = strdup(value))) {
+ virReportOOMError();
+ goto error;
+ }
+
+ if (virTypedParameterAssign(*params + n, name,
+ VIR_TYPED_PARAM_STRING, str) < 0) {
+ VIR_FREE(str);
+ goto error;
+ }
+
+ *nparams += 1;
+ return 0;
+
+error:
+ virDispatchError(NULL);
+ return -1;
+}
